PSY Gangnam Style views crossed the YouTube’s 32-bit counter limit

PSY Gangnam Style was released back in 2012 and it was an instant hit. It gained the status of YouTube’s most watched video, with 800 million views, breaking the record of Justin Bieber’s ‘Baby’. Then later that year, in December, it crossed the 1 billion views for the first time in History. Today it crossed another mark.

Gangnam Style has been viewed so many times that it crossed the 32-bit integer limit which is 2,147,483,647.  According to YouTube, they never thought that any video would be so awesome to cross the limit of 2.1 billion. PSY now has over 7.5 million subscribers on his YouTube channel.

YouTube has now upgraded its counter to 64-bit which is capable of counting up to 9,223,372,036,854,775,808. This equals about 9.2 quintilian which is probably enough forever.
